Latest Patents

Theo Cachet holds a patent titled "Demonstration-conditioned reinforcement learning for few-shot imitation." This patent describes a computer-implemented method for performing few-shot imitation. The method involves obtaining training data associated with specific tasks, training a policy network using reinforcement learning, and maximizing performance based on reward functions. This innovative approach allows for the effective execution of new tasks by leveraging prior demonstrations.
